Emergency Medical Science
A.A.S. Degree Program
Become a paramedic where you will do something different every day, for every call. Become well-versed in rescue skills, knowledge of fire scene operations, hazardous materials response, vehicle extrication, and self defense. This curriculum is designed to prepare graduates to enter the workforce as paramedics. Additionally, the program can provide an Associate Degree for individuals desiring an opportunity for career enhancement. Further education can lead to careers with rescue teams and supporting law enforcement or in wildland fire suppression, critical care, incident command, and many other opportunities.

A.A.S. Degree and Certificate Programs
Ready to start or upgrade your career in Fire Protection Technology? Fire protection encompasses not only the fire service, represented by our community’s fire department and its members, but the civilians who work for fire departments in various roles, those who work elsewhere in government in fire-related roles, and those in the private sector who are involved in fire prevention or related pursuits. Learn about hydraulics, hazardous materials, arson investigation, fire protection safety, fire suppression management, law, and codes.
